B.Sc. in Nursing (Post Basic) at Vinayaka Mission's College of Nursing, Kirumampakkam Overview
Vinayaka Mission's College of Nursing, Kirumampakkam, Vinayaka Mission's Research Foundation B.Sc. in Nursing (Post Basic) is one of the popular courses offered by the institution. This course runs for a duration of 2 years. Students who wish to make a career in Nursing can opt for the course. The total tuition fee for this course is INR 70,000. The institution offers 30 seats for the B.Sc. in Nursing (Post Basic) course. Students need to appear for CBSE 12th for admission to this course. The various reasons for flunking nursing classes are so numerous, yet unique to each and every person. Some of the main causes that normally lead to one experiencing academic difficulties in nursing classes are:
- Difficulty understanding concepts: The nursing programs are demanding, and it is genuinely tough to grasp very complicated medical concepts, procedures, and pharmacology.
- Clinical performance problems: These can be concerns for students who are experiencing complications with clinical skills or interpersonal communications.
- Poor study habits: One of the most important study skills in any nursing program. A student who does not have proper study habits, time management, or organizational skills might not manage to keep pace according to coursework.
- Overwhelmed by workload: The workload, in particular, can be intense in nursing programs, leaving the students overwhelmed as to what to learn and acquire, complete as assignments, and spend in clinical hours.
